#8252e8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8252e8 is composed of 51% red, 32.2%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44% cyan, 64.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 259.2 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 61.6%. #8252e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a4ff with #0500d1. Closest websafe color is: #9966ff.

#8252e8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8252e8 has RGB values of R:130, G:82, B:232 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0.65,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 8540904.

Hex triplet 8252e8 #8252e8
RGB Decimal 130, 82, 232 rgb(130,82,232)
RGB Percent 51, 32.2, 91 rgb(51%,32.2%,91%)
CMYK 44, 65, 0, 9
HSL 259.2°, 76.5, 61.6 hsl(259.2,76.5%,61.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 259.2°, 64.7, 91
Web Safe 9966ff #9966ff
CIE-LAB 47.76, 52.986, -69.125
XYZ 26.786, 16.606, 78.134
xyY 0.22, 0.137, 16.606
CIE-LCH 47.76, 87.096, 307.471
CIE-LUV 47.76, 7.532, -108.931
Hunter-Lab 40.751, 46.017, -85.154
Binary 10000010, 01010010, 11101000

Shades and Tints of #8252e8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f3eef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#8252e8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9a96a4 is the less saturated color, while #7a3bff is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#8252e8 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#717171 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#746b89 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#0075e4 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#007bc9 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#687b84 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#2f68e5 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#2f6cd4 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#716ca8 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
